Hackers Broadcast AI-Generated Video of Trump Kissing Musk’s Feet on Government Monitors

On Monday morning, employees at the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) in Washington, D.C., were met with an unexpected and unsettling sight. Television screens throughout the building, including those in the cafeteria, displayed an AI-generated video depicting President Donald Trump kissing the feet of tech billionaire Elon Musk. The video, accompanied by the caption “LONG LIVE THE REAL KING,” played on a continuous loop, causing confusion and concern among staff.

The incident occurred as federal employees returned to the office following an executive order ending remote work. The provocative nature of the video, combined with its sudden appearance, led to immediate efforts to halt its broadcast. Building staff, unable to stop the video through standard controls, resorted to manually unplugging the affected televisions to cease the display.

HUD spokesperson Kasey Lovett addressed the situation, stating, “Another waste of taxpayer dollars and resources. Appropriate action will be taken for all involved.” The source of the hack remains under investigation, with no individual or group yet claiming responsibility.

This event comes amid heightened scrutiny of the relationship between President Trump and Elon Musk. Musk, who has been a significant financial supporter of Trump’s political endeavors, holds a prominent advisory position within the administration. Recent policy decisions, including substantial proposed cuts to HUD’s workforce, have intensified discussions about Musk’s influence over federal operations.

The use of AI-generated content in this hack highlights growing concerns about the potential for deepfake technology to disseminate misleading or provocative material. As the investigation continues, questions arise regarding the security of government communication systems and the broader implications of artificial intelligence in media manipulation.
